{"id":9618109563154,"title":"The Bot Platform Create a User Attribute Integration","handle":"the-bot-platform-create-a-user-attribute-integration","description":"\u003ch2\u003eUnderstanding the \"Create a User Attribute\" API Endpoint on The Bot Platform\u003c\/h2\u003e\n\n\u003cp\u003eThe Bot Platform provides a variety of tools designed to help developers create interactive, automated bots for messaging platforms like Facebook Messenger, WhatsApp, and more. Among its various features, one of the endpoints offered by The Bot Platform API is \"Create a User Attribute.\" This particular API functionality allows developers to define and create new attributes for user profiles managed by the bot. Understanding how it can be applied and what problems it solves is critical for optimizing the user experience and bot performance.\u003c\/p\u003e\n\n\u003ch3\u003eWhat Can Be Done with the \"Create a User Attribute\" API Endpoint?\u003c\/h3\u003e\n\n\u003cp\u003eThis API endpoint serves a fundamental role in personalizing the conversation experience and enabling the bot to handle user data effectively. Here's what you can achieve with it:\u003c\/p\u003e\n\n\u003cul\u003e\n \u003cli\u003e\n\u003cstrong\u003eUser Personalization:\u003c\/strong\u003e By creating user attributes, developers can store specific information about users, such as names, preferences, or past interactions. This enables the bot to deliver a tailored experience, addressing users by name or recalling particular user preferences.\u003c\/li\u003e\n \u003cli\u003e\n\u003cstrong\u003eData Segmentation:\u003c\/strong\u003e Attributes can be used to segment users based on various criteria such as location, language, or behavior. This segmentation allows for targeted messaging and campaigns, improving engagement and response rates.\u003c\/li\u003e\n \u003cli\u003e\n\u003cstrong\u003eEnhanced Interactivity:\u003c\/strong\u003e With custom attributes, the bot can track user inputs or choices throughout a conversation. This data can be used to guide the flow of the conversation and present relevant options or information to the user.\u003c\/li\u003e\n \u003cli\u003e\n\u003cstrong\u003eImproved Analytics:\u003c\/strong\u003e By monitoring user attributes, developers can gain insights into user behavior patterns and preferences. This information is valuable for optimizing the bot's performance and making data-driven decisions.\u003c\/li\u003e\n\u003c\/ul\u003e\n\n\u003ch3\u003eProblems Solved by the \"Create a User\n\nAttribute\" API Endpoint\u003c\/h3\u003e\n\n\u003cp\u003eUsing the \"Create a User Attribute\" functionality, several challenges can be addressed:\u003c\/p\u003e\n\n\u003col\u003e\n \u003cli\u003e\n\u003cstrong\u003eLack of Personalization:\u003c\/strong\u003e One of the most common complaints about bots is that they can feel impersonal. With user attributes, the bot can remember details about the user, making interactions feel more individualized and engaging.\u003c\/li\u003e\n \u003cli\u003e\n\u003cstrong\u003eInefficient Data Handling:\u003c\/strong\u003e Without a structured way to handle user data, bots can become inefficient and less effective. The endpoint allows for organized data management, which is critical for maintaining a smooth and responsive user experience.\u003c\/li\u003e\n \u003cli\u003e\n\u003cstrong\u003eDifficulty in Tracking User Progress:\u003c\/strong\u003e In scenarios where the bot is guiding a user through a process or a set of steps, keeping track of progress is essential. User attributes can store this information, allowing the bot to resume interactions from the correct point even after interruptions.\u003c\/li\u003e\n \u003cli\u003e\n\u003cstrong\u003ePoor User Engagement:\u003c\/strong\u003e By not leveraging user data effectively, bots could miss opportunities to engage users in a meaningful way. Well-defined user attributes support the creation of compelling and relevant content that resonates with the user.\u003c\/li\u003e\n\u003c\/ol\u003e\n\n\u003cp\u003eOverall, the \"Create a User Attribute\" endpoint of The Bot's Platform API is a powerful tool for enhancing the capability of bots to offer a personalized, interactive, and efficient messaging experience. By utilizing this functionality, developers can design bots that are not only more user-friendly but also more effective in achieving business goals such as improved customer service, higher engagement, and better conversion rates.\u003c\/p\u003e","published_at":"2024-06-21T09:29:55-05:00","created_at":"2024-06-21T09:29:56-05:00","vendor":"The Bot Platform","type":"Integration","tags":[],"price":0,"price_min":0,"price_max":0,"available":true,"price_varies":false,"compare_at_price":null,"compare_at_price_min":0,"compare_at_price_max":0,"compare_at_price_varies":false,"variants":[{"id":49672157528338,"title":"Default Title","option1":"Default Title","option2":null,"option3":null,"sku":"","requires_shipping":true,"taxable":true,"featured_image":null,"available":true,"name":"The Bot Platform Create a User Attribute Integration","public_title":null,"options":["Default Title"],"price":0,"weight":0,"compare_at_price":null,"inventory_management":null,"barcode":null,"requires_selling_plan":false,"selling_plan_allocations":[]}],"images":["\/\/consultantsinabox.com\/cdn\/shop\/files\/7f08cf9294a83556f6003fa57ee5a1a8_36c91e79-07bf-4951-a36d-d20d2cf3803d.png?v=1718980196"],"featured_image":"\/\/consultantsinabox.com\/cdn\/shop\/files\/7f08cf9294a83556f6003fa57ee5a1a8_36c91e79-07bf-4951-a36d-d20d2cf3803d.png?v=1718980196","options":["Title"],"media":[{"alt":"The Bot Platform Logo","id":39832169349394,"position":1,"preview_image":{"aspect_ratio":3.325,"height":123,"width":409,"src":"\/\/consultantsinabox.com\/cdn\/shop\/files\/7f08cf9294a83556f6003fa57ee5a1a8_36c91e79-07bf-4951-a36d-d20d2cf3803d.png?v=1718980196"},"aspect_ratio":3.325,"height":123,"media_type":"image","src":"\/\/consultantsinabox.com\/cdn\/shop\/files\/7f08cf9294a83556f6003fa57ee5a1a8_36c91e79-07bf-4951-a36d-d20d2cf3803d.png?v=1718980196","width":409}],"requires_selling_plan":false,"selling_plan_groups":[],"content":"\u003ch2\u003eUnderstanding the \"Create a User Attribute\" API Endpoint on The Bot Platform\u003c\/h2\u003e\n\n\u003cp\u003eThe Bot Platform provides a variety of tools designed to help developers create interactive, automated bots for messaging platforms like Facebook Messenger, WhatsApp, and more. Among its various features, one of the endpoints offered by The Bot Platform API is \"Create a User Attribute.\" This particular API functionality allows developers to define and create new attributes for user profiles managed by the bot. Understanding how it can be applied and what problems it solves is critical for optimizing the user experience and bot performance.\u003c\/p\u003e\n\n\u003ch3\u003eWhat Can Be Done with the \"Create a User Attribute\" API Endpoint?\u003c\/h3\u003e\n\n\u003cp\u003eThis API endpoint serves a fundamental role in personalizing the conversation experience and enabling the bot to handle user data effectively. Here's what you can achieve with it:\u003c\/p\u003e\n\n\u003cul\u003e\n \u003cli\u003e\n\u003cstrong\u003eUser Personalization:\u003c\/strong\u003e By creating user attributes, developers can store specific information about users, such as names, preferences, or past interactions. This enables the bot to deliver a tailored experience, addressing users by name or recalling particular user preferences.\u003c\/li\u003e\n \u003cli\u003e\n\u003cstrong\u003eData Segmentation:\u003c\/strong\u003e Attributes can be used to segment users based on various criteria such as location, language, or behavior. This segmentation allows for targeted messaging and campaigns, improving engagement and response rates.\u003c\/li\u003e\n \u003cli\u003e\n\u003cstrong\u003eEnhanced Interactivity:\u003c\/strong\u003e With custom attributes, the bot can track user inputs or choices throughout a conversation. This data can be used to guide the flow of the conversation and present relevant options or information to the user.\u003c\/li\u003e\n \u003cli\u003e\n\u003cstrong\u003eImproved Analytics:\u003c\/strong\u003e By monitoring user attributes, developers can gain insights into user behavior patterns and preferences. This information is valuable for optimizing the bot's performance and making data-driven decisions.\u003c\/li\u003e\n\u003c\/ul\u003e\n\n\u003ch3\u003eProblems Solved by the \"Create a User\n\nAttribute\" API Endpoint\u003c\/h3\u003e\n\n\u003cp\u003eUsing the \"Create a User Attribute\" functionality, several challenges can be addressed:\u003c\/p\u003e\n\n\u003col\u003e\n \u003cli\u003e\n\u003cstrong\u003eLack of Personalization:\u003c\/strong\u003e One of the most common complaints about bots is that they can feel impersonal. With user attributes, the bot can remember details about the user, making interactions feel more individualized and engaging.\u003c\/li\u003e\n \u003cli\u003e\n\u003cstrong\u003eInefficient Data Handling:\u003c\/strong\u003e Without a structured way to handle user data, bots can become inefficient and less effective. The endpoint allows for organized data management, which is critical for maintaining a smooth and responsive user experience.\u003c\/li\u003e\n \u003cli\u003e\n\u003cstrong\u003eDifficulty in Tracking User Progress:\u003c\/strong\u003e In scenarios where the bot is guiding a user through a process or a set of steps, keeping track of progress is essential. User attributes can store this information, allowing the bot to resume interactions from the correct point even after interruptions.\u003c\/li\u003e\n \u003cli\u003e\n\u003cstrong\u003ePoor User Engagement:\u003c\/strong\u003e By not leveraging user data effectively, bots could miss opportunities to engage users in a meaningful way. Well-defined user attributes support the creation of compelling and relevant content that resonates with the user.\u003c\/li\u003e\n\u003c\/ol\u003e\n\n\u003cp\u003eOverall, the \"Create a User Attribute\" endpoint of The Bot's Platform API is a powerful tool for enhancing the capability of bots to offer a personalized, interactive, and efficient messaging experience. By utilizing this functionality, developers can design bots that are not only more user-friendly but also more effective in achieving business goals such as improved customer service, higher engagement, and better conversion rates.\u003c\/p\u003e"}